Key Differences
In short — Core i7-7700 outperforms the cheaper Core i5-661 on the selected game parameters. However, the worse performing Core i5-661 is a better bang for your buck. The better performing Core i7-7700 is 2553 days newer than the cheaper Core i5-661.
Advantages of Intel Core i5-661
- Up to 52% cheaper than Core i7-7700 - $80.0 vs $167.0
- Up to 40% better value when playing Rust than Core i7-7700 - $0.52 vs $0.86 per FPS
Advantages of Intel Core i7-7700
- Performs up to 25% better in Rust than Core i5-661 - 194 vs 155 FPS
- Consumes up to 25% less energy than Intel Core i5-661 - 65 vs 87 Watts
- Can execute more multi-threaded tasks simultaneously than Intel Core i5-661 - 8 vs 4 threads
